9 * page_is_file_lru - should the page be on a file LRU or anon LRU?
10 * @page: the page to test
12 * Returns 1 if @page is a regular filesystem backed page cache page or a lazily
13 * freed anonymous page (e.g. via MADV_FREE). Returns 0 if @page is a normal
14 * anonymous page, a tmpfs page or otherwise ram or swap backed page. Used by
15 * functions that manipulate the LRU lists, to sort a page onto the right LRU
18 * We would like to get this info without a page flag, but the state
19 * needs to survive until the page is last deleted from the LRU, which
20 * could be as far down as __page_cache_release.
22 static inline int page_is_file_lru(struct page *page)
24 return !PageSwapBacked(page);
